Morphogenesis
Description
The process whereby animals and plants (and possibly organizations and societies) acquire form and structure. For example, the process by which a nearly undifferentiated droplet of protoplasm, the fertilized ovum, becomes eventually transformed or transforms itself into the complex architecture of the multicellular organism.
